Vin Diesel and dance track? That’s something you’ve never expect to hear in the same sentence.
Well it turns out Diesel has a new collaboration with Steve Aoki that he reckons could win him his first Grammy award. While speaking to the Los Angeles Times, Diesel Facetimed with Aoki to assist him in retelling the anecdote, which involved the pair making a “monster track” together in Vegas. “What Vin brought to the table, I’ve never experienced before,” Aoki said.
“I think it’s going to blow people’s minds,” the cake throwing producer continued. Later in the interview, Diesel turned to his assistant, who films everything the actor does, and said: “I’m gonna get a Grammy before I get an Oscar!”
Unfortunately no further details about the collaboration were revealed to the Times, including release date or track title. Diesel did, however, say he cried when he played it to his girlfriend and mother of his children, Paloma Jimenez.
